The Evolution of Online Directories: From Yellow Pages to Digital Tools

The concept of directories has been around for decades, with traditional directories like the Yellow Pages serving as a fundamental resource for finding information. However, the digital age has transformed this landscape dramatically. This article explores the evolution of online directories and how they have revolutionized web navigation.

The Early Days of Online Directories

In the early days of the internet, users relied heavily on simple online directories that mirrored traditional print formats. Websites like Yahoo, launched in 1994, began as a directory of links categorized by subject matter. This marked a significant shift in how users navigated the web, moving from printed books to clickable links.

The Rise of Search Engines

As the web expanded, search engines like Google emerged, providing a different approach to finding information. Rather than manually browsing through categorized links, users could now enter search terms and retrieve a list of results in seconds. While search engines offered speed, they often lacked the curated quality that dedicated directories provided.

Specialized Online Directories

With the growth of niche markets, specialized online directories began to emerge. These directories served specific purposes, catering to industries like travel, finance, and health. Sites such as TripAdvisor and Yelp focused on user-generated content, allowing consumers to share reviews and recommendations, thus enhancing the overall directory experience.

The Role of Social Media

Social media platforms have also played a significant role in the evolution of online directories. Platforms like Facebook and Instagram allow users to discover businesses and services through friends and followers. The social aspect of these directories enhances trust and reliability, as users can rely on personal recommendations rather than anonymous reviews.

Contemporary Online Directory Trends

Today’s online directories are more dynamic than ever. They often incorporate advanced technologies like AI and machine learning to provide personalized recommendations based on user preferences. Modern directories also prioritize mobile-friendliness, ensuring users can access information on-the-go.
